Affected products
Visonic PowerMax Express and PowerMax Complete Panels
Product description
This recall involves the Visonic PowerMax Express and PowerMax Complete control panels with software version 15. The control panels are professionally installed, and have an LCD display and icon-based keypad.

Hazard identified
Visonic has become aware of an issue affecting PowerMax Express PowerMax Complete panels with software version 15 used in these devices. The external memory in these devices, which contains panel configuration, LCD texts and predefined SMS messages, can be eventually overwritten by the device’s event log file. This condition takes approximately one to three years to occur (depending on daily levels of system activity). The resulting impact on the panel’s operation is that false events, such as power failure and zone trouble, will be displayed on the panel and will be reported to the central monitoring station; and panels that are configured to send SMS messages, will send corrupted SMS messages. Eventually, real alarm events will not be sent to the central monitoring station, and periodic tests done by the end users will fail. Safety detectors such as smoke, gas, etc. are unaffected and will sound a local alarm if an event occurs.
Neither Health Canada nor Visonic has received any reports of consumer incidents or injuries related to the use of this product.
Number sold
Approximately 69 units were sold in Canada through professional alarm installers.
Time period sold
The recalled panels were sold from February 2012 to February 2014.
Place of origin
Manufactured in Israel.

What you should do
Consumers with affected units should contact their dealer/installer/distributor or contact Visonic to receive instructions for repair of their panel.
For more information, consumers may contact Visonic’s support center (North America) toll free at 1-844-888-2391, from 8:30 a.m. to 6:00 p.m. EST, Monday through Friday.
Please note that the Canada Consumer Product Safety Act prohibits recalled products from being redistributed, sold or even given away in Canada.
